Kathmandu, 16 December : Human defenders have asked the rebellious group led by Netra Bikram Chand aka 'Biplav to shun violence and come to negotiation table. Founding chairperson of Human Rights and Peace Society, Krishna Pahadi too has asked 'Biplav'-led group carrying out violent activities in the country to join talks. "Biplav Ji, understand the situation and come to the peace process," he told to Chand at a press conference organised here on Sunday by the Human Rights and Peace Society, Rupandehi. Viewing that there is a need at people level to put pressure on the group to end violence, he stressed the need for the government not to resort to a policy of suppression in this regard.
